First Trust Advisors LP lifted its stake in shares of Olin Corporation (NYSE:OLN – Free Report) by 80.8%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 713,041 shares of the specialty chemicals company’s stock after buying an additional 318,588 shares during the quarter. First Trust Advisors LP’s holdings in Olin were worth $21,199,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Olin Stock Up 3.9%
Shares of OLN opened at $22.19 on Thursday. Olin Corporation has a 12 month low of $18.08 and a 12 month high of $30.46. The firm’s 50 day moving average is $22.95 and its 200-day moving average is $24.80. The stock has a market capitalization of $2.53 billion, a PE ratio of -19.82 and a beta of 1.21. The company has a current ratio of 1.36, a quick ratio of 0.82 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.73.

Olin Company Profile
Olin Corporation is a diversified manufacturer specializing in chemical products and ammunition. The company’s core business activities encompass the production and distribution of chlor-alkali products, epoxy resins and derivatives, and small-caliber ammunition under the Winchester brand. Olin’s chemical operations supply chlorine, caustic soda and related co-products to a wide range of end markets, including water treatment, pulp and paper, pharmaceuticals and general industrial applications.
In its Chlor Alkali Products & Vinyls segment, Olin operates multiple manufacturing facilities that produce chlorine and sodium hydroxide, along with vinyl chloride monomer and polyvinyl chloride (PVC) compounds.
